区块链技术近年来已经成为了信息技术领域的热门话题,改变了许多行业的运作方式。区块链的核心在于其独特的结构,通常由三大技术架构组成:基础架构、共识机制和网络架构。本文将对这三大架构进行深度解析,并探讨它们各自的特点与功能,以及未来的发展趋势和应用前景。
基础架构是区块链技术的核心,包括了数据库系统、加密算法和智能合约等元素。它提供了一个安全、透明和去中心化的平台,使得数据无法被篡改,确保了信息的真实性和可靠性。
在区块链的基础架构中,最关键的就是分布式账本技术。它将数据分割成一个个“区块”,并通过密码学技术将这些区块串联在一起,形成一个永久、不变的链条。这种设计确保了数据在无中心服务器的情况下仍然可以安全地保存和验证。
加密算法是保护区块链安全性的另一重要组成部分。当前常用的加密算法包括SHA-256等,这些算法不仅能保证数据的完整性,还能保护用户隐私。智能合约则是在链上执行的自执行程序,它允许交易的自动化,减少了人为错误和操作成本。
共识机制是区块链中保障网络参与者对数据一致性达成协议的重要机制。它是区块链能正常运行的基础,确保所有节点在新增数据时能够达成一致。目前常见的共识机制有工作量证明(PoW)、权益证明(PoS)和拜占庭容错(BFT)等。
工作量证明机制是比特币所采用的主要共识机制,它要求矿工进行复杂的计算工作,以便验证交易并生成新的区块。这种机制虽然安全性高,但由于需要消耗大量计算资源,也被指责为不环保。
相较之下,权益证明机制通过持有者的资产数量来决定谁能够参与区块创建,减少了资源的浪费。拜占庭容错机制则强调安全性和可靠性,通过增加网络节点的数量来防止恶意攻击。
共识机制的选择与区块链的类型和应用场景密切相关,不同的共识机制各有优劣,开发者需根据实际需求进行选择。
网络架构是区块链的另一个重要构成部分,决定了区块链的运营方式和交互模式。根据节点之间的关系,区块链网络可分为公有链、私有链和联盟链。
公有链是完全开放的,任何人都可以参与。比特币和以太坊就是典型的公有链实例。公有链的优势在于去中心化,但面临着性能瓶颈和隐私问题。
私有链则是由特定组织或机构控制,具有更高的速度和隐私性,适合企业应用。联盟链是由多个机构共同管理,搭建在公有链和私有链之间,旨在兼顾去中心化与高效性能。
通过合理的网络架构设计,区块链能够更灵活地适应不同的业务需求,同时也为未来的技术进步提供了可能的方向。
分布式账本是区块链的核心概念之一,而区块链本质上就是一种特殊的分布式账本。与传统的集中式数据库不同,分布式账本将数据存储在网络中的每一个节点,所有参与者都能拥有相同的数据副本。这种设计使得数据难以篡改,极大地增强了安全性。
每当有新的交易或信息需要被记录在账本上时,这一信息会被同时传播给网络中的所有节点,经过验证后,再通过协议将其添加到链中。由于每个节点都有记录的副本,即使某个节点失效,网络仍然能够正常运作。
此外,分布式账本的透明性使得所有交易对所有参与者开放,这种透明性有助于提升信任度,并推动各行各业的数字化转型,从金融到供应链管理,都依赖这种技术来确保数据的真实性与不可篡改性。
共识机制是确保区块链网络各个节点对数据一致性确认的协议方式,通常有三种主要类型:工作量证明(PoW)、权益证明(PoS)和拜占庭容错机制(BFT)。
工作量证明机制依赖于大量的计算能力进行交易验证,虽然安全性高,但其效率低,且消耗大量能源。代表案例是比特币,其矿工为每个新区块的创建竞争,过程耗时且动辄需数万元的设备投资。
权益证明机制则是基于节点所持有的币值来决定生成新区块的权利,显著减少了计算资源消耗,因此在效率和环保方面表现更好。以太坊2.0项目正在逐步转向这一机制。
拜占庭容错机制则是通过引入多重节点相互验证,增强网络的抗攻击能力。适用于需要高度安全性的场景,如金融交易和合约执行等,但实现上更为复杂,对网络性能也会造成一定影响。
区块链技术在企业中的应用日益广泛,尤其是金融、供应链及智能合约等领域。以金融为例,许多银行正在探索利用区块链进行国际汇款及清算。通过去中心化的账本,交易更快且透明,减少了资金占用和手续费。
在供应链管理中,区块链能够追溯整个产品生命周期,确保所有环节的可追踪性与透明度。例如,某些食品企业正在利用区块链记录每一笔产品的生产、运输和销售信息,提升了消费信心,减少了食品安全问题。
智能合约的应用也为企业提供了无限可能性。通过在链上编写合约,企业能够自动执行合约条款,减少中介角色,降低了成本。这种特性在房地产交易、保险索赔等领域表现突出,显著提高了效率和透明度。
随着技术的不断进步,区块链的未来发展趋势也愈加清晰。首先,跨链技术将成为主要发展方向,允许不同区块链之间相互关联,从而实现更大的互操作性,让用户能够更加无缝地进行资产转移和信息交流。
其次,隐私保护技术也将得到进一步改善,通过零知识证明和多方计算等新技术,公司可以在保护用户隐私的同时,依然满足法规要求。此外,由于环境问题及能源消耗问题,越来越多的区块链平台开始探索更为环保的共识机制,如权益证明和委托权益证明。
最后,政策和监管环境也将进一步成熟。各国政府正积极研究如何在保障用户权益的同时,不妨碍创新。未来,合理的监管将是推动区块链技术及其应用进一步发展的基石。
总体而言,区块链作为一种革命性技术,正快速渗透各行各业。通过对基础架构、共识机制和网络架构的深刻理解,企业和个人能够更好地把握这一技术带来的机遇与挑战。随着技术的不断进步,区块链的应用前景将更加广阔,值得我们期待。
2003-2025 易欧 @版权所有|网站地图|辽ICP备19003898号-1